Dihydromyrcene structure

Dihydromyrcene

TL;DR: Dihydromyrcene (CAS 2436-90-0) is a chemical compound with molecular formula C10H18 and molecular weight 138.14 g/mol, supplied by Kehong Biological (Henan Kehong Biological Technology Co., Ltd.) with CRO/CDMO custom synthesis services.

3,7-dimethylocta-1,6-diene

Also Known As: DIHYDROMYRCENE, 3,7-Dimethylocta-1,6-diene, Citronellene, 3,7-Dimethyl-1,6-octadiene, dihydro myrcene

CAS: 2436-90-0
Molecular Formula C10H18
Molecular Weight 138.14 g/mol
LogP 4.2
Topological Polar Surface Area 0.0 Ų
Hydrogen Bond Donors 0
Hydrogen Bond Acceptors 0
Rotatable Bonds 4
Exact Mass 138.14085
Heavy Atoms 10
Complexity 116.0
Vapor Pressure 2.57 [mmHg]

Chemical Identifiers

CAS Number 2436-90-0
SMILES CC(CCC=C(C)C)C=C
InChIKey FUDNBFMOXDUIIE-UHFFFAOYSA-N
